网站500错误 5步快速修复指南

网站500错误:原因分析与快速修复指南

网站500错误 5步快速修复指南

当用户访问网站时遇到“500 Internal Server Error”(服务器内部错误),不仅影响用户体验,还可能降低搜索引擎排名。作为常见的HTTP状态码之一,500错误表明服务器端出现问题,但未提供具体原因。本文将深入解析500错误的常见诱因,并提供实用的解决方案,帮助站长快速恢复网站正常运行。

一、什么是网站500错误?

500错误属于服务器端错误响应,通常由网站程序、服务器配置或资源权限问题引发。与404(页面不存在)不同,500错误的责任方在网站服务器,而非用户操作。由于错误提示信息模糊,排查难度较高,但通过日志分析或逐步测试,可以定位到具体原因。

二、500错误的常见原因

1. 代码错误:PHP、Python等后端脚本语法错误或逻辑冲突; 2. 服务器配置不当:如.htaccess文件规则错误、内存不足; 3. 插件/主题冲突:WordPress等CMS的扩展组件兼容性问题; 4. 数据库连接失败:账号密码错误或表结构损坏; 5. 权限设置错误:文件或目录读写权限不足。

三、如何快速诊断与修复?

1. 检查服务器日志:通过cPanel或SSH查看error_log,定位报错文件及行号; 2. 禁用插件/主题:临时切换至默认主题或停用插件,排查兼容性问题; 3. 验证文件权限:确保关键目录(如wp-content)权限为755,文件为644; 4. 测试数据库:使用phpMyAdmin修复损坏的表或检查连接配置; 5. 联系主机商:若问题持续,可能是服务器资源超限或防火墙拦截。

四、预防500错误的最佳实践

1. 定期备份数据:确保故障时可快速回滚; 2. 更新软件版本:保持CMS、插件及PHP版本兼容性; 3. 监控工具:使用UptimeRobot等工具实时监测网站状态; 4. 代码审查:修改核心文件前进行本地测试。

:高效应对500错误,保障网站稳定

500错误虽令人头疼,但通过系统化排查和规范运维,完全可以快速解决并预防复发。站长应掌握基础服务器管理技能,同时善用日志工具和监控服务,将故障影响降至最低。稳定的网站不仅是用户体验的基石,更是SEO优化的关键因素。

本文转载自互联网,如有侵权,联系删除

本文地址:https://www.tukunet.com/post/6749.html

相关推荐

发布评论